Definition and Scope:
Intraosseous implants are medical devices used in dentistry to support dental prostheses by being inserted into the bone of the jaw. These implants provide a stable foundation for artificial teeth, bridges, or dentures. The procedure involves drilling into the jawbone to place the implant, which then fuses with the bone over time through a process called osseointegration. Intraosseous implants are typically made of biocompatible materials such as titanium, which have the ability to integrate well with the surrounding bone tissue. This results in a strong and durable support structure for dental restorations, offering patients a long-term solution for missing teeth.
The market for intraosseous implants is experiencing steady growth driven by several key factors. One of the primary drivers is the increasing prevalence of dental conditions such as tooth decay, gum disease, and dental trauma, leading to a rising demand for dental implants as an effective treatment option. In addition, technological advancements in implant materials and design have improved the success rates of intraosseous implant procedures, making them more appealing to both patients and dental professionals. Moreover, the growing aging population worldwide is contributing to the expansion of the market, as older individuals are more prone to tooth loss and may seek implant-supported restorations for improved oral health and quality of life.
Furthermore, the rising awareness about the benefits of intraosseous implants compared to traditional removable dentures or fixed bridges is also fueling market growth. Intraosseous implants offer greater stability, functionality, and aesthetics, leading to higher patient satisfaction rates. Additionally, the increasing disposable income in emerging economies is enabling more individuals to afford dental implant procedures, driving market expansion. Overall, the market for intraosseous implants is expected to continue growing as technological innovations, demographic trends, and shifting consumer preferences shape the landscape of dental care and treatment options.
